Solway is an old-established residential suburb near the Waingawa River in the south-western part of Masterton, the principal town in the Wairarapa Valley of New Zealand's North Island. It was a small part of Manaia run on which Masterton is built. [3] It takes its present name from Solway House built in 1877 for W. H. Donald.

    On 31 May 1919, Masterton became the first town in New Zealand to have a fully automatic (Western Electric 7A Rotary) telephone exchange. Masterton and nearby Carterton were the first towns in New Zealand to introduce the emergency number 111, in September 1958.     The Ruamahanga River runs through the southeastern North Island of New Zealand . The river's headwaters are in the Tararua Range northwest of Masterton. From there it runs firstly south and then southwest for 130 kilometres (81 mi) before emptying into the Cook Strait. The towns of Masterton and Martinborough are close to the banks of the river.
